Robert Barton "Bullet Bob" Westfall (May 5, 1919 – October 23, 1980) was an American professional football fullback who played for the Detroit Lions of the National Football League (NFL). He played college football for the Michigan Wolverines, where he was selected as a consensus first-team All-American in 1941. In 1987, Westfall was enshrined in the College Football Hall of Fame.
